Reproduction fungi reproduce sexually and/or asexually As such, the evolution and maintenance of meiosis and sexual reproduction within these fungi represents the most basic of functions and generally supports the hypothesis that sex, and more specifically meiosis, arose as a means of dna repair following the exposure to adverse environmental conditions. Perfect fungi reproduce both sexually and asexually, while imperfect fungi reproduce only asexually (by mitosis)

In both sexual and asexual reproduction, fungi produce spores that disperse from the parent organism by either floating on the wind or hitching a ride on an animal. Mating in fungi fungi are a diverse group of organisms that employ a huge variety of reproductive strategies, ranging from fully asexual to almost exclusively sexual species

[1] most species can reproduce both sexually and asexually, alternating between haploid and diploid forms.
